Men’s SCARPA Maestrale RS Alpine Touring Backcountry & Alpine Ski Boot – White/Black/Azur – 29

cheap  src=
/10Our Score
Key Features
  • For the uncompromising backcountry skier. Stable yet lightweight, the Maestrale RS combines the performance needed for his long backcountry tours with incredible downhill prowess.
  • Carbon Grilamid LFT Shell Grilamid Bio Evo V-Frame Cuff A lightweight carbon/grilamid shell optimizes energy transfer while an eco-friendly bio-based cuff provides torsional stiffness on descents and greater freedom of movement in walk mode.
  • Easy to operate, even when wearing gloves, Speed ​​Lock XT ski/walk levers reduce snow and ice build-up for quick, hassle-free transitions.
  • Thermomoldable Liner SCARPA’s Pro Flex Performance Liner is warm, adjustable and provides a precise fit in cold conditions for all-day comfort.
  • Weight – 3 lbs 3.1 oz (1/2 pair, size 27). The last one is 101mm. Flex-125; Range of Motion – 60°; Binding Compatibility – TLT, AT. Forward lean – 16° ∓ 2°

SCARPA Maestrale XT Alpine Touring Men’s Backcountry and Alpine Ski Boot – Anthracite/Azur – 27

powerful Alpina Sports Montana Backcountry Cross Country Boots, Brown/Black, Euro 44
/10Our Score
Key Features
  • For big descents in the backcountry. The Maestrale XT is the toughest and most powerful boot in the SCARPA Touring range, offering high levels of performance for his demanding backcountry skiers.
  • Dual Layer Injected Grilamid Carbon Grilamid LFT Shell These two different materials provide a combination of stiffness and torsional rigidity without sacrificing strength or weight.
  • efficient closure. A dual-buckle cuff closure secures two buckles at half the weight, combined with a lower wave closure system for zero-backlash power transfer.
  • Thermoformable Liner SCARPA’s Intuition Pro Flex Ride Liner is warm and adjustable for a precise fit and all-day comfort in cold conditions.
  • Weight – 3 lbs 4.6 oz (1/2 pair, size 27). The last one is 101mm. Flex-130; Range of Motion – 56°; Binding Compatibility – TLT, AT. Forward lean – 16° ∓ 2°
